LiverMultiScan was found to be a cost-effective, noninvasive alternative to surveillance liver biopsies in the AIH patient care pathways of NHS England, across disease stages, in an early economic model developed by @OxfordAHSN.

NEW! With @PerspectumGroup we’ve published a health economic evaluation in @BMJ_Open of a non-invasive scan as an alternative to liver biopsy which could benefit patients with autoimmune hepatitis and cut NHS costs. Read our paper here: bmjopen.bmj.com/content/12/9…
